About The Role

FDM is a global business and technology consultancy seeking a Senior PMO Analyst to work for our client within the public sector. This is initially a 4 month contract with the potential to extend and will be a hybrid role based at one of several office locations across the North and South of the UK. 

As a Senior PMO Analyst you will play an important role in defining, building and monitoring the client's ambitious roadmap of digital and business transformation, focusing on operational and regulatory effectiveness and efficiency whilst improving overall portfolio outcomes.

You will be responsible for working with a variety of operational delivery specialisms across a sub section of the portfolio to improve project and programme delivery compliance. You will also define and embed the standards for delivery and assurance management, ensuring all aspects of delivery compliance are governed and assured to support in delivering their ambitions transformation agenda.

Focused on monitoring best practice standards to drive the collective delivery of organisational outcomes that will improve regulatory effectiveness and efficiency and improve project and programme compliance you will help lead, drive and deliver significant change, driven by a new strategy and a number of new and challenging transformation programmes.

Responsibilities:

  • Lead assurance activities including health checks, deep dives and stage gateway reviews to ensure that all projects/programmes are effectively managing risks, scope, plans and finances in line with PMO standards
  • Work with business areas to identify and categorise new projects that relate to their portfolio area, utilising portfolio management and multi criteria analysis to determine strategic value and prioritisation
  • Identify and monitor portfolio level risks and issues and escalate as appropriate
  • Maintain portfolio Finance / RAID and Planning trackers and create high quality reports for a variety of stakeholders with different requirements
  • Working with the Planning Manager to develop mechanisms for measuring and monitoring delivery and tracking dependencies across the portfolio
  • Co-ordinate reporting from projects and programmes and provide analysis of performance
  • Develop the Centre of Excellence, providing expert advice to Project/Programme Managers and senior leaders on correct processes, templates and governance procedures
  • Play a key role in developing and implementing the client's Change Framework
  • Manage and engage with a wide range of stakeholders, acting as an arbitrator to resolve disputes relating to area of expertise and provide expert advice and peer reviews where required.
  • Support the PMO Portfolio Manager and Head of Service to communicate and build commitment to a shared PMO vision and sense of purpose
  • Lead lessons learned and post implementation reviews and embed into future project delivery
  • Provide direct training as well as coach and mentor other project professionals on PMO standards
  •  May work independently or leading a small team operating across various specialisms to support the development and communication of change and business improvement principles, guidelines and best practice  to build knowledge and optimise service delivery.

About You

  • PMO Delivery: You will have an excellent working knowledge of best practice Project and Change Delivery processes (RAID Management / Planning / Resource management / Finance etc.) with hands-on project / programme experience. At least 7 years of experience in a similar role.
  • MI / Reporting: You know how to create high quality Management Information, including dashboards, milestones reports, cross-Government reporting packs to agreed standards and templates, with a focus on strategic products for Senior Executive Boards, and internal / external assurance panels.
  • Lessons Learned: You know how define and manage the lessons learned process, facilitating workshops and ensuring lessons are communicated and embedded across the portfolio and considered throughout the project lifecycle to reduce risk
  • Tools: You will be Extremely proficient in PowerPoint / Excel / MS Project / SharePoint with experience of data analysis and generating Management Information (MI) reports, ideally automatically, for multiple audiences including project reviews, programme delivery review, leadership team and board executives
  • Communication: You will have excellent written and verbal communication skills, providing effective summaries & briefings for all stakeholders including material which could be used for external audiences, with close attention to detail, good organisational skills, and the ability to develop and implement effective processes
  • Business Analysis: You know how to develop effective monitoring systems to track movement and expected deliverables across a sub-portfolio . Through a keen eye for detail, you can identify variations or delays, and take appropriate action to escalate deteriorating positions
  • Domain Level Experience: You know how to quickly build up a high-level understanding of domain specific functions for instance, procurement, operational delivery, Digital and IT transformation to support the assurance and challenge of delivery plans and compliance activity
  • Compliance: You know how to set the standards for delivery and work with project teams to track and monitor project / programme progress throughout the life of interrelated projects and programmes across the portfolio. You can act as a recognised expert and advocate for best practice approaches, continuously reflecting and challenging the team
  • Stakeholder relationship management: You know how to direct the strategic approach for stakeholder relationships, establishing and promoting the meeting of stakeholder objectives. You are able to actively manage stakeholders and create a compelling case for change

Qualifications

  • A relevant Project / Portfolio Management qualification (Prince2, MSP, MOP, Agile etc.)
